Ether was used widely for surgeries but became less popular because of its flammability and its tendency to cause vomiting. In England, it was quickly replaced by chloroform, but this agent caused many deaths and lost popularity.

There used to be a metric calendar, as well as metric clocks. The metric calendar, or "French Republican Calendar" divided the year into 12 months, but each month was divided into three 10-day weeks. Each day had 10 decimal hours. Each hour had 100 decimal minutes. Due to lack of popularity, the metric clocks and calendars were ended in 1795, three years after they had been first marketed.

In 1885, the Lloyd Manufacturing Company of Albany, New York, promoted and sold "Cocaine Toothache Drops" at 15 cents per bottle! In 1914, the Harrison Narcotic Act brought the sale and distribution of this drug under federal control.
